Alert Details
Flood Warning issued by NWS San Juan PR, effective from April 16, 2026, at 12:06 PM AST.
Affected Areas
Yabucoa, Puerto Rico, including low-level bridges along Rio Guayanes.
What You Should Do
Turn around, don't drown when encountering flooded roads. Do not attempt to cross flooded roads and find an alternate route.
Expected Conditions
Flooding caused by excessive rainfall is expected. Between 3 and 5 inches of rain have fallen, with rivers, cre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ations imminent or occurring. Low-water crossings are inundated and may not be passable.
Timeline
The alert is effective from April 16, 2026, at 12:06 PM AST until April 18, 2026, at 9:00 AM AST.
